7. Chilika Lake:

Chilika Lake in Odisha is the largest internal salt-water lake in Asia. This lake is a paradise on Earth for nature lovers and bird watchers. A vibrant variety of birds, including the native and migratory ones, come to this lake every day. Flamingos, white-bellied sea eagles, golden plover, and sandpiper are some of the commonly seen birds in this lake.

The beautiful sunrise and sunset here offer you a great scenic view. The pear-shaped lake is dotted with some small islands and it has fisheries around its shore. The lake also boasts of being one of the two sites in the worlds where the endangered Irrawaddy dolphins can be seen.

Some of the key attractions include Bird Island, Honeymoon Island, Breakfast Island, etc. Visit the Chilika lake to spend a day in nature’s company and enjoy tranquility like never before.

8. Dhauli:

Dhauli is situated on the banks of Daya river and is close to Bhubaneshwar, at a distance of 8 kilometers from the capital city of Odisha. Dhauli has got its significance from the Kalinga war, which is believed to be fought on the Dhauli hill. Shanti Stupa is a famous Stupa here, which attracts tourists from various places. This place is one of the famous tourist places in the state.

Key attractions of Dhauli are Dhauli Shanti Stupa, Kalinga War Battlefield, Dhabaleswar, and CIFA Aquarium. The best time to visit this tourist destintion in Odisha is from July to February.

15. Similipal National Park, Baripada:

Similipal National Park is the largest wildlife sanctuary of India. It is in Mayurbhanj, Odisha. This reflects the natural beauty of Odisha. The National Park is situated in Mayurbhanj. It is considered as one of the important tiger projects in the country. The entire area of Similipal National Park is rich with dense forest, meadows, startling waterfalls, and alluring rivers. The place is blessed with a great biodiversity and huge number of fauna. The Similipal Tiger Reserve has more than 1000 varieties of plants and has around 96 species of orchids. The nearest town to the Similipal Tiger Reserve is Baripada.

You can hire a jeep for a jungle safari and set out into the forest for enjoying the natural beauty while exploring the wilds. You can rest in the rest house, go to the nearby restaurants and enjoy local food here. Best time for visiting this place is from November to June.

23. Satakosia Tiger Reserve:

The Satakosia Tiger Reserve is located at a distance of 160 km from Bhubaneswar. The Tiger reserve was built since 1976 and it is a home to many tigers in the moist, deciduous forests of the Eastern Ghats. There are also elephants, birds, and few other animals in this place. You can go for boating and can spot the river-inhabitants being, like the Indian fish-eating crocodile and Gharials. The river Mahanadit passes through a 14 mile long gorge. There are a lot of stay-places near this place. Various lodging options are available, which are operated by the Odisha Forest Development Corporation in Satakosia. You can also see the Kuanria Deer Park and Dam along with the Kantilo Neelamadhav Temple near the Satakosia Tiger Reserve.
